Before you start
What to have ready
A utility area, treatment process, distribution zone, or operational workflow to start with.
Assets, sources, lab records, GIS, and work context for that boundary.
Operating KPIs such as quality, reliability, pressure, energy, chemical use, or compliance readiness.
A clear handoff path into work, field response, or reporting.
Usage workflow
How to use Water OS
Open the command center
Start from Water OS to view the operating context, readiness state, source health, and priority workflows.
Validate the system map
Confirm source facts, objects, assets, relationships, treatment context, and network context for the first boundary.
Use operating modules
Move into treatment operations, network operations, chemical operations, quality/regulatory, public safety, or semantic board views.
Review AI assistance
Use the copilot for interpretation and next-step suggestions, then keep actions routed through approved workflows.
